The Los Angeles Lakers took on the Memphis Grizzlies in Memphis tonight and fell 107-102.

I know how much everyone cares about Kobe’s shot attempts, and tonight in the fourth quarter, Bryant broke the NBA record for most missed field goal attempts in a career.

Speaking of Kobe Bryant, he put together a nice game.  Bryant scored 28 points, grabbed 7 boards, dished out 6 assists, and had 4 steals in the loss.

Carlos Boozer had his best game as a Laker before fouling out in the fourth quarter. Boozer scored 20 points and grabbed 8 rebounds for the squad.

Wesley Johnson came to play tonight. After struggling earlier this season he scored 15 points while hitting 3, three pointers tonight. Jordan Hill was a monster on the glass. He collected a double-double as he scored 13 points and grabbed 14 rebounds. All 5 Lakers starters reached double figures.

On the other hand, the Memphis Grizzlies were coming off their first loss of the season to the Milwaukee Bucks.  Tonight, 6 different players reached double figures for the Grizz.

Beno Udrih and Kosta Koufos were excellent off the bench. Udrih went 8-11 from the floor, scoring 16 points, while Koufos went 5-5 and scored 14. Mike Conley had a big game. The Ohio State product scored 23 points and had 3 steals.

Zach Randolph had a double-double, and Marc Gasol nearly had a triple-double. Gasol scored 8 points, grabbed 7 rebounds, and dished out 9 assists.

The Lakers losing by 5 points tonight is ironic because in the middle of third quarter they gave up a 5 point play. After a Mike Conley kicked his leg out on a three-point attempt and received the foul call, Byron Scott let the refs have it. Scott was awarded a technical, thus giving the Grizzlies the rare 5 point play.
